Understanding Financial Independence
Financial independence refers to the state where an individual can live comfortably without being reliant on employment income. Essentially, it's about having enough assets and income-generating investments to cover one’s expenses, allowing for personal choice in work, leisure, and lifestyle. Knowing your numbers is crucial for achieving this goal, as it helps in setting actionable retirement savings targets and realistic lifestyle expectations.

Is the calculator accurate for long-term planning?
While it provides valuable estimates based on input data and assumptions, the actual outcomes may vary based on factors like investment performance and inflation.
How often should I update my inputs in the calculator?
It’s advisable to revisit and update the calculator at least annually or whenever you experience significant life changes, such as a salary increase, job change, or altering your retirement plans.
